l Attachment I to ET 91-0047 Page 8 of 11 A review was performed on the impact of extending the A0Ts for those '

SSPS functions (i.e., steam generator level low-low, phase A containment isolation, safety injection, and SSPS logic) which provide input to plant-specific design features such as BOP ESFAS.

Implementation of the following plant-specific functions is affected by any change in signal availability to or from the BOP ESFAS:

(a) containment purge isolation (Functional Unit 3.c)

(b) auxiliary feedwater initiation (Functional Unit 6.d)

(c) control room ventilation isointion (Functional Unit 9)

No changes are proposed to the technical specification requirements for the BOP ESFA ' actuation logic and relays (i.e., no changes are proposed for Functional Units 3.c.3), 6.c. or 9.c) and the unavailability of the BOP ESPAS itself remains unchanged. For the above functions (a) through (c), overall function unavailability is made up of two ceparate components representing SSPS unavailability and BOP ESFAS unavailability, the latter remaining unchanged. As reported in Tables 3.6-6 and 3.6-9 of WCAP-10271, Supplement 2, Revision 1, typical unavailability for safety injection and auxiliary feedwater pump start increased by a factor of 3 to 6. Given that the BOP ESFAS unavailability does not change, the overall functional unavailability increase would be bounded by the factor of 3 to 6 inctaase in SSPS unavailability, regardless of what value is assigned to the BOP ESPAS unavailability (typical value is SE-04). Similar conclusions can also be drawn for Functional Units 4 and 5 which are implemented via the Main Steam / Main Feedwater Isolation Actuation System.

Therefore, the overall impact of the changes in SSPS unavailability resulting from the generic technical specification changes on the affected plant-specific ESFAS functions remains within the bounds of the generic analysis,

b. SER Condition - Confirm that any increase in instrument drift due to the extended STIs is properly accounted for in the setpoint calculation methodology. '

Response -

From the monthly ACOTs performed on the ESPAS instrumentation, WCNOC collects the 'as found" and 'as left' data including accumulated drift for trending of calibration /setpoint drift. A review of this data confirmed that the setpoint drift which could be expected under the extended STIs remains within the existing allowance in the ESFAS instrument setpoint calculation. To support this conclusion, "as found" and 'as left" data for those ESFAS channels with increased STIs will be collected over a one year period after quarterly testing is begun. WCNOC will review this data to verify that any setpoint drift remains within the existing allowance in the ESFAS instrument setpoint calculation.

Attachment II to ET 91-0047 Page 3 of 3 Standard 2 - Create the Possibility of a New or Different Kind of Accident from any Previously Analyzed.

The proposed changes do not involve hardware changes and do not result in a change in the manner in which the RTS or ESFAS provide plant protection. No change is being made which alters the functioning of the RTS or ESFAS. Rather the likelihood or probability of the RTS or ESFAS functioning properly is affected as described above. Therefore the proposed changes do not create the possibility of a new or different kind of accident.

Standard 3 - Involve a Significant Reduction in a Margin of Safety.

The proposed changes do not alter the manner in which safety limits, limiting safety system settings, or limiting conditions for operation are determined.

The impact of reduced testing, other than as addressed above, is to allow a longer time interval over which instrument uncertainties (e.g., drift) may act. The review of existing monthly calibration /setpoint drift data for ESFAS instrumentation addresses this concern. Implementation of the proposed changes is expected to result in an overall improvement in safety, as follows:

a. Reduced testing will result in fewer inadvertent reactor trips, less frequent actuation of ESFAS components, and less frequent distraction of operations personnel.
b. Improvements in the effectiveness of the operating staff in monitoring and controlling plant operation will be realized. This is due to less frequent distraction of the operators and shift supervisor to attend to instrumentation testing,
c. Longer repair times associated with increased A0Te will lead to higher quality repairs and improved reliability.

Based on the above discussions, it has been determined that the proposed technical specification revisions do not involve a significant increase in the probability or consequences of an accident previously evaluated or create the possibility of a new or different kind of accidents or involve a significant reduction in a margin of safety. Therefore, this amendment application does not involve a significant hazards consideration.
